diff options
| author | William A. Kennington III <wak@google.com> | 2019-04-03 20:40:16 -0700 |
|---|---|---|
| committer | William A. Kennington III <wak@google.com> | 2019-04-03 20:43:17 -0700 |
| commit | 3cf374edeba12ac21eb1f9666e95712e50ac7872 (patch) | |
| tree | 73c546c907f1a08f736393529a3332976165454d /tools | |
| parent | 8cd7a4a10c02a450bc21580a4bde34328a841d13 (diff) | |
| download | sdbusplus-3cf374edeba12ac21eb1f9666e95712e50ac7872.tar.gz sdbusplus-3cf374edeba12ac21eb1f9666e95712e50ac7872.zip | |
sdbus++: Fix mako include substitution for signals
This allows the signal generator to emit include directives
Change-Id: I47a13102491116772c31b57ca58824fda3612938
Signed-off-by: William A. Kennington III <wak@google.com>
Diffstat (limited to 'tools')
| -rw-r--r-- | tools/sdbusplus/templates/interface.mako.server.cpp.in |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/tools/sdbusplus/templates/interface.mako.server.cpp.in b/tools/sdbusplus/templates/interface.mako.server.cpp.in index 0043f75..a47ff38 100644 --- a/tools/sdbusplus/templates/interface.mako.server.cpp.in +++ b/tools/sdbusplus/templates/interface.mako.server.cpp.in @@ -3,12 +3,9 @@ #include <sdbusplus/server.hpp> #include <sdbusplus/exception.hpp> #include <${"/".join(interface.name.split('.') + [ 'server.hpp' ])}> -% for m in interface.methods: +% for m in interface.methods + interface.properties + interface.signals: ${ m.cpp_prototype(loader, interface=interface, ptype='callback-cpp-includes') } % endfor -% for p in interface.properties: -${ p.cpp_prototype(loader, interface=interface, ptype='callback-cpp-includes') } -% endfor <% namespaces = interface.name.split('.') classname = namespaces.pop() |

